white house decision bypass President Biden with US Marines as he delivered a speech that raised alarms about authoritarian impulses of former President Donald Trump and his supporters have sparked controversy over what is appropriate use of in military.

Biden speaking at Independence Hall in Philadelphia on On Thursday evening he said that democracy and equality were under threat and that he wanted “speak as directly as I can to the nation” about threats against them. Trump and his allies are a form of extremism that “threatens the very foundations of our republic,” Biden said, adding that while “mainstream” Republicans respect rule of law, former the president is not.

Biden made a speech in front of in building where the US constitution was written like two marines in dress blues standing in background. Red light bathed building and marines.

Presidents have long used US troops and military equipment as they refer to the American people. But military officials often sought to narrow how people in form is drawn into the political spotlight, holding on to the belief that military is an institution that protects all Americans regardless of of political affiliation.

White House officialSpeaking on condition of anonymity because of in sensitivity of in the issue acknowledged that the administration made conscious decision turn on the marines for symbolism.

“The President made an important speech last a night about our democracy and our values, the values ​​that our men as well as women in a uniform fight protect every day official said in statement. “Presence of The Marines’ performance was meant to demonstrate a deep and enduring respect for the president. for their service to these ideals and unique role our independent military games in defend our democracy no matter what party is in power”.

For some scientists who study civilmilitary affairs, use of The Marine Corps as a backdrop for the speech was unreasonable.

Peter Feaver, professor at Duke University, said that while presidents are political actors, they “need be careful not to bring military in the frame when they are engaged in partisan, political actions.

“In this case, the choice is to literally leave the Marines guard in the frame was wrong oneFever said. who expressed concern about how Trump politicized military on numerous cases. “He may even have effect of distracts from the message people argue about optics, not about essence of President’s speech.

lindsey Cohn, who studies civilmilitary affairs at the Naval Academy, said Biden being framed by the Marines during the speech was “not a crisis, but it could have been should been avoided.”

Cohn said she sees an argument for Biden delivering a necessary and candid speech. in that he explicitly noted that not all Republicans were a threat. But she added that the Biden administration needs to be “overly sensitive and careful about optics to try to amplify some of norms” that the Trump administration has loosened.

Appeal to US troops at the Pentagon in February 2020 at the beginning of of his administration, Biden said he would never disrespect them and “would never politicize work you do.”

Biden critics – including many who remained silent during Trump battles with Pentagon – lashed out on in use of Marines.

“The only thing worse than a Biden speech that devastated his fellow citizens is to turn around in our flag and Marines to make it happen,” Rep. Darrell Issa (R-CA) tweeted.

James Hutton, Veterans Affairs official during the Trump administration, tweeted that Biden “used Marines as props.” for his divisive and overtly political speech.”

Biden supporters responded by pointing out out numerous ways Trump has undermined non-partisan nature of in military.

In June 2020 he was looking for for days before use active-duty US troops to quell protests provoked by police killing of George Floyd, anxiety senior Pentagon officials who saw him plans like abuse of power. On high of crisis, federal forces ousted protesters from Place Lafayette outside of The White House before Trump took over others senior US officials at a nearby church for photo opportunity. General Mark A. Milley, Chairman of Joint Chiefs of Staff, later apologized for appearance with president briefly outside White House, declaring that his presence in this moment “created the perception of in military involved in domesticated politics”.

At the beginning of During his administration, Trump went to the Pentagon and signed executive acts, including an executive order aimed at severely curbing immigration from several Muslim-majority countries. countries. He did it in Hall of the Pentagon of Heroes”, a hall dedicated to the military medal of Respect recipients.
